What should you do following the car crashes

It is crucial to remain calm in the aftermath of an accident, regardless of whether you're injured or not. You should not leave your car unless it is safe. Medical professionals must treat injured patients immediately and the police must arrive to complete an official report.

When you've gotten out of your vehicle, try to take photos or video of the scene. This will help your accident lawyer in Houston determine the cause of the accident and then prove it in court. Take pictures of any relevant details, such as the vehicles involved as well as the road conditions.

While you're there, exchange details with all those involved in the crash. This means getting their name, phone number, insurance company, and driver's license number. Also, you should inquire about witnesses and get their name and contact information. If they hold an driver's license, make sure to get the license plate number, too.

You should also record any information you remember, before your memory wane. This could include the date and time the accident occurred and at what time and where the accident occurred. It's also a good idea to take note of the weather conditions too.

If you are able, it's recommended to take as many photos of the scene as you can, especially in the event that there are witnesses at the scene. You can use your cell phone to take these photos, or if you are disabled after the accident, ask a witness to take the pictures for you. Try to take close-up photos of the damage caused by the car and distant shots of the scene.

Take pictures of any skid marks or damaged guardrails in the area. Also, take photos of any visible injuries you have suffered in the accident. Examine yourself and your passengers for any scrapes or cuts. If you're able to to, take pictures of any bruises or other injuries. Finally, be sure to take a copy of the police report. Get Medical Attention

If you were involved in a car crash it is essential to get medical attention as soon as possible. Whatever the severity you believe your injuries to be visiting a doctor can help you identify any conditions that have developed due to the incident. A medical evaluation could also be used as proof of your injuries in the event that you have to submit a lawsuit or a claim.

In many cases, symptoms of injury caused by a car accident might not manifest until a few days, hours or even weeks after the crash. This is because our bodies respond to stress by releasing hormones that mask pain for a short period of time. What feels like an unimportant bump or ache in immediate aftermath of a crash may turn into a debilitating condition if not treated.

You will be asked a series of questions by a doctor about your feelings prior to and after an accident. Be honest with your answers so that the doctor can assess your injuries.

If your injuries aren't life-threatening, you can decide between visiting an emergency room at a hospital or an urgent care center. Both will provide the medical treatment you require, and provide documentation of your injuries to support an insurance claim or legal proceeding.

Some people don't seek medical attention because they believe that their injuries will go away on their own or that the injury was caused by something other than an accident. In the absence of seeking medical attention, it could be detrimental to your health as well as your ability to receive compensation for any damages.
